Transaction 8413f5bac56da3edb63b9a296fdeede87cde6a507f3751a85bf6d28a105fbbd4
1 Input
1 Output
-
8413f5bac56da3edb63b9a296fdeede87cde6a507f3751a85bf6d28a105fbbd4:0
- value
- 19441500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93a46c745265c870d81d06ae3dbe4917b93149cf OP_EQUAL
- address
- 3F9gE6exAJ4vkpRfJ84WggMtwiR1hNWFoW